The car is based on the Boss 302. The special edition - Laguna Seca is designed specially for the weekend racers, who can drive it to and at the coarse and back home, without any concerns.

It features Black or Ingot Silver paint, red accents, revised aggressive front spoiler from Boss 302R, a bigger rear spoiler, huge 19" wheels with R-compound high performance tires.

Inside, Boss 302 Laguna Seca includes sport seats, a revised instrument cluster, an Alcantara steering wheel, dark metallic trim, and a black pool-cue shifter. Furthermore, the weight is reduced by removing rear seat and replacing it with an X-brace that increases chassis stiffness by 10 per cent.

The suspension is slightly improved by stiffened springs and a larger rear stabilizer bar.

Boss 302 Laguna Seca is powered by 5.0 liter V8 with 440hp (328 kW) and 515Nm of torque (380lb-ft). The engine is mated with a six-speed close-ratio manual gearbox, which sends power to the rear wheels through a Torsen LSD (Limited Slip Differential).

The improvements gained Laguna Seca better stopping distance (by three feet), faster 0-60mph time (one tenth of a second), more lateral acceleration and overall expected lap time improvement of one to two seconds over the standard Boss 302.
